Mississippi crews try to stay safe amid excessive heat

Published

on

www.wjtv.com – Tia McKenzie – 2023-07-21 16:30:18

SUMMARY: Record-breaking temperatures are causing concerns for workers in industries like construction. The National Weather Service (NWS) reports that excessive heat is the leading cause of weather-related deaths in the United States. Matt Martin, a production supervisor at Watkins Roofing and Construction in Mississippi, emphasizes the importance of hydration for workers in his industry. He suggests using products like Pedialyte and wet rag towels to stay cool. Martin is grateful that his company has not experienced any heat-related illnesses this year. The extreme heat serves as a reminder for workers to take precautions to prevent heat stroke and heat exhaustion.

Caledonia hosts 20th annual Caledonia Day Festival

Published

on

www.wcbi.com – Khamari Haymer – 2024-10-19 18:48:00

SUMMARY: Caledonia Day, the town’s largest annual , celebrates community with food, music, and vendors. Betty Darnell emphasizes its role in bringing locals and visitors together, showcasing small businesses. The also includes a car show and ‘s activities, providing a vibrant atmosphere for socializing. Attendees, like Charlie Sullivan and Avery Hodge, appreciate the to connect with friends and try local offerings. Organizers, chairman Kelsey Kendrick, highlight the joy of seeing families gather and children play. This year marked the 20th anniversary of Caledonia Day, reflecting the event’s significance to the community.
